    Your key responsibilities

    Typical activities will include the following:

    • Manage client relationships/expectations and develop client portfolio.
    • Develop relations with existing clients in order to gather feedback on the quality of work delivered and to gain ideas for improvement of services delivered.
    • Effectively manage audit teams and actively coach and develop team members
    • Active involvement in the recruitment of staff
    • Plan and manage own performance and development
    • Develop technical expertise -both functional and industry
    • Responsible for planning and managing assignments for compliance with all technical requirements including:
    • Final technical review at all stages and for raising with partners all pertinent issues.
    • Reviewing and approving for partner's signature all financial statements, opinions and reports and other deliverable documents for clients
    • Ensuring management letters are constructive, commercially aware and demonstrate the firm's interest in the client's business.
    • Obtaining consultation from experts on complex issues

    Responsible for handling various assignments concurrently, including:

    Pre Audit / other project:

    • Preparation of audit project proposals, budgets, negotiations over fee and contract terms.

    Audit field work:

    • Monitoring audit progress including compliance with budgets and deadline.
    • Ensuring that audit work is being allocated to team members on a level commensurate with their past experience
    • Review of audit work papers and reporting to the relevant partner / director

    Post Audit

    • Adequate fee recovery, variance analysis, billing procedures and pursuing overdue accounts.
    • Arrangement of closing meeting including preparation of support for agenda.
    • Controlling preparation of final version accounts and reports.

    To qualify for the role you must have

    • Proven track record of outstanding performance.
    • Worked on Large / Multinational clients
    • Clearly demonstrate an on-going commitment to personal and professional development through continuing education and development.
    • Qualified Accountant -e.g. ACA, ACCA, CPA qualified
    • Minimum of 3 years relevant post qualification experience, including at least one in a role as an audit manager or with equivalent experience
    • Ability and willingness to work primarily on challenging and complex projects
    • Experience with International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) & "new" UK GAAP
    • An ability to manage projects and teams
    • High Technical Knowledge
    • Excellent commercial, management and organisational skills
    • Excellent communication skills both written and verbal
